Feasibility Studies
A feasibility study determines whether a project is viable, investable, and technically sound. By combining rigorous data analysis with financial and technical validation, our feasibility process mitigates risk, quantifies project potential, and provides a clear pathway to execution.

Step 1: Discovery & Alignment
Establishing the foundation for a successful feasibility study
- Introductory Call – Initial discussion to assess project scope, feedstock availability, and commercial potential.
- Confidentiality Agreement – Execution of an NDA to enable full data-sharing.
- Detailed Project Discussion – A deep dive into feedstock type, ownership, availability, cost, site details, and local economic conditions.
- Engagement Agreement – Formalising the next steps in the feasibility process.


Step 2: Economic Viability Assessment (EVA)
A high-level financial screening to determine project potential
A Go/No-Go decision-making tool providing an early financial outlook to determine whether the project warrants further investment into a full feasibility study and bespoke financial modelling.
- Summarised financial insights based on key project parameters.
- Total projected costs, revenues, and yields over the project’s lifespan.
- Key Performance Indicators (KPIs) such as IRR, ROI, and payback period to assess financial viability.
- Industry benchmarking to contextualise project performance against similar developments.
Step 3: Costing & OPEX Validation
A high-level financial screening to determine project potential
Before conducting a full feasibility study, detailed cost estimates must be developed for local materials, construction, labour, and ongoing operational expenses.
- Local Construction Costing – Establishing price estimates for all non-technology components (site preparation, infrastructure, balance of plant, utilities, etc.).
- Labour & Salary Benchmarking – Determining local wages, taxation, and workforce availability.
- Utility & Feedstock Pricing Validation – Assessing energy, water, and biomass supply costs.
- OPEX Forecasting – Generating an accurate operational cost model that feeds into financial projections.


Step 4: Full Feasibility Study
A detailed technical, commercial, and regulatory assessment
Once cost assumptions are validated, a comprehensive feasibility study is conducted to confirm project viability.

- Technical Feasibility – Technology selection, facility design, and process optimisation.
- Regulatory & Policy Compliance – Permitting, incentive structures, and environmental impact assessments.
- Financial Insights – Key financial outputs derived from CDRX’s proprietary model (but without full access to the model itself).
Step 5: Bespoke Financial Model Development
A fully customised financial model designed for investor engagement and project execution
For clients requiring a full, investor-ready financial model, CDRX offers bespoke model development as a standalone service. This model is built on FAST standards and provides detailed financial outputs tailored to the project’s specific conditions.
- Custom financial modelling, including detailed CAPEX, OPEX, and revenue projections.
- Scenario analysis, risk modelling, and sensitivity testing.
- Debt and equity structuring, DSCR calculations, and funding optimisation.
